Try Phoenix Air, based in Cartersville, GA (about 30 minutes northwest of Atlanta). They have added 3 G1159's (2 G-III's and 1 G-IISP) to their fleet of many G-159's and Lears in the last year and would most likely enjoy getting somebody with time in type. I would expect more additions in the Gulfstream jet side as well. Phoenix Air is very specialized flying, though; Look through their website, PM me if you have questions.
